之前写了一篇文章:Java 网络IO编程总结(BIO、NIO、AIO均含完整实例代码),介绍了如何使用Java原生IO支持进行网络编程,本文介绍一种更为简单的方式,即Java NIO框架.

Netty是业界最流行的NIO框架之一,具有良好的健壮性、功能、性能、可定制性和可扩展性。同时,它提供的十分简单的API,大大简化了我们的网络编程.

同Java IO介绍的文章一样,本文所展示的例子,实现了一个相同的功能.

package com.anxpp.io.calculator.netty;
import io.netty.bootstrap.ServerBootstrap;
import io.netty.channel.ChannelFuture;
import io.netty.channel.ChannelInitializer;
import io.netty.channel.ChannelOption;
import io.netty.channel.EventLoopGroup;
import io.netty.channel.nio.NioEventLoopGroup;
import io.netty.channel.socket.SocketChannel;
import io.netty.channel.socket.nio.NioServerSocketChannel;
public class Server {
   private int port;
   public Server( int port) {
     this .port = port;
   }
   public void run() throws Exception {
     EventLoopGroup bossGroup = new NioEventLoopGroup();
     EventLoopGroup workerGroup = new NioEventLoopGroup();
     try {
       ServerBootstrap b = new ServerBootstrap();
       b.group(bossGroup, workerGroup)
        .channel(NioServerSocketChannel. class )
        .option(ChannelOption.SO_BACKLOG, 1024 )
        .childOption(ChannelOption.SO_KEEPALIVE, true )
        .childHandler( new ChannelInitializer<SocketChannel>() {
          @Override
          public void initChannel(SocketChannel ch) throws Exception {
            ch.pipeline().addLast( new ServerHandler());
          }
        });
       ChannelFuture f = b.bind(port).sync();
       System.out.println( "服务器开启:" +port);
       f.channel().closeFuture().sync();
     } finally {
       workerGroup.shutdownGracefully();
       bossGroup.shutdownGracefully();
     }
   }
   public static void main(String[] args) throws Exception {
     int port;
     if (args.length > 0 ) {
       port = Integer.parseInt(args[ 0 ]);
     } else {
       port = 9090 ;
     }
     new Server(port).run();
   }
}

package com.anxpp.io.calculator.netty;
import io.netty.buffer.ByteBuf;
import io.netty.buffer.Unpooled;
import io.netty.channel.ChannelHandlerContext;
import io.netty.channel.ChannelInboundHandlerAdapter;
import java.io.UnsupportedEncodingException;
import com.anxpp.io.utils.Calculator;
public class ServerHandler extends ChannelInboundHandlerAdapter {
   @Override
   public void channelRead(ChannelHandlerContext ctx, Object msg) throws UnsupportedEncodingException {
     ByteBuf in = (ByteBuf) msg;
     byte [] req = new byte [in.readableBytes()];
     in.readBytes(req);
     String body = new String(req, "utf-8" );
     System.out.println( "收到客户端消息:" +body);
     String calrResult = null ;
     try {
       calrResult = Calculator.Instance.cal(body).toString();
     } catch (Exception e){
       calrResult = "错误的表达式:" + e.getMessage();
     }
     ctx.write(Unpooled.copiedBuffer(calrResult.getBytes()));
   }
   @Override
   public void channelReadComplete(ChannelHandlerContext ctx) throws Exception {
     ctx.flush();
   }
   /**
    * 异常处理
    */
   @Override
   public void exceptionCaught(ChannelHandlerContext ctx, Throwable cause) {
     cause.printStackTrace();
     ctx.close();
   }
}

package com.anxpp.io.calculator.netty;
import io.netty.bootstrap.Bootstrap;
import io.netty.channel.ChannelFuture;
import io.netty.channel.ChannelInitializer;
import io.netty.channel.ChannelOption;
import io.netty.channel.EventLoopGroup;
import io.netty.channel.nio.NioEventLoopGroup;
import io.netty.channel.socket.SocketChannel;
import io.netty.channel.socket.nio.NioSocketChannel;
import java.util.Scanner;
public class Client implements Runnable{
   static ClientHandler client = new ClientHandler();
   public static void main(String[] args) throws Exception {
     new Thread( new Client()).start();
     @SuppressWarnings ( "resource" )
     Scanner scanner = new Scanner(System.in);
     while (client.sendMsg(scanner.nextLine()));
   }
   @Override
   public void run() {
     String host = "127.0.0.1" ;
     int port = 9090 ;
     EventLoopGroup workerGroup = new NioEventLoopGroup();
     try {
       Bootstrap b = new Bootstrap();
       b.group(workerGroup);
       b.channel(NioSocketChannel. class );
       b.option(ChannelOption.SO_KEEPALIVE, true );
       b.handler( new ChannelInitializer<SocketChannel>() {
         @Override
         public void initChannel(SocketChannel ch) throws Exception {
           ch.pipeline().addLast(client);
         }
       });
       ChannelFuture f = b.connect(host, port).sync();
       f.channel().closeFuture().sync();
     } catch (InterruptedException e) {
       e.printStackTrace();
     } finally {
       workerGroup.shutdownGracefully();
     }
   }
}

package com.anxpp.io.calculator.netty;
import io.netty.buffer.ByteBuf;
import io.netty.buffer.Unpooled;
import io.netty.channel.ChannelHandlerContext;
import io.netty.channel.ChannelInboundHandlerAdapter;
import java.io.UnsupportedEncodingException;
public class ClientHandler extends ChannelInboundHandlerAdapter {
   ChannelHandlerContext ctx;
   /**
    * tcp链路简历成功后调用
    */
   @Override
   public void channelActive(ChannelHandlerContext ctx) throws Exception {
     this .ctx = ctx;
   }
   public boolean sendMsg(String msg){
     System.out.println( "客户端发送消息:" +msg);
     byte [] req = msg.getBytes();
     ByteBuf m = Unpooled.buffer(req.length);
     m.writeBytes(req);
     ctx.writeAndFlush(m);
     return msg.equals( "q" )? false : true ;
   }
   /**
    * 收到服务器消息后调用
    * @throws UnsupportedEncodingException
    */
   @Override
   public void channelRead(ChannelHandlerContext ctx, Object msg) throws UnsupportedEncodingException {
     ByteBuf buf = (ByteBuf) msg;
     byte [] req = new byte [buf.readableBytes()];
     buf.readBytes(req);
     String body = new String(req, "utf-8" );
     System.out.println( "服务器消息:" +body);
   }
   /**
    * 发生异常时调用
    */
   @Override
   public void exceptionCaught(ChannelHandlerContext ctx, Throwable cause) {
     cause.printStackTrace();
     ctx.close();
   }
}

package com.anxpp.io.utils;
import javax.script.ScriptEngine;
import javax.script.ScriptEngineManager;
import javax.script.ScriptException;
public enum Calculator {
   Instance;
   private final static ScriptEngine jse = new ScriptEngineManager().getEngineByName( "JavaScript" );
   public Object cal(String expression) throws ScriptException{
     return jse.eval(expression);
   }
}
